#7bbdea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7bbdea is composed of 48.2% red, 74.1%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 19.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 204.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 70%. #7bbdea color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#007bd5.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#7bbdea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7bbdea has RGB values of R:123, G:189,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 8109546.

Shades and Tints of #7bbdea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f1f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bbdea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0b3b5 is the less saturated color, while #69c0fc is the most saturated one.
